Don’t worry, it’s beyond simple to use. This notepad trick works because of HTML’s “contenteditable” attribute that can turn any part of a web page into an interactive area for editing text.
If you ever need a quick scratchpad to just write, not save what you write, but just write, you can quickly turn your web browser into an ultra-basic notepad with a single line of HTML.
